Direct Airport to City Centre Service
Dublin Express Route 785
Route 785 connects Dublin Airport directly with Belfast Grand Central Station, one of the city’s main transport hubs. This central drop off point makes it easy to continue your journey on foot, by taxi, or using local public transport once you arrive.
Because the route is designed for long distance travellers, it operates with limited stops, helping to keep journey times as short and predictable as possible.

How Route 785 Compares to Other Ways of Getting to Belfast
Travellers often compare buses, trains, and car hire when planning a journey between Dublin Airport and Belfast.
Travelling by train usually requires first getting from Dublin Airport to a city centre station, then transferring again in Belfast. This adds time and complexity, especially with luggage. Car hire offers flexibility but can be expensive and involves navigating unfamiliar roads and border routes.
Dublin Express Route 785 provides a direct, single journey from airport to city centre, making it the fastest and most straightforward option for many travellers.
